The Arellano University School of Law (AUSL) is the law school of Arellano University. AUSL was established in 1938, making it one of the oldest law schools in the Philippines.[1][2] The school was managed by the Arellano Law Foundation, a non-stock and non-profit organization established by the alumni and faculty members of AU since 1979.[1] AUSL was considered a model institution by the Commission on Higher Education for providing quality education and producing successful graduates.[3]
